> Are there ./configure options which will result in building a 32 bit
> version of gdb. I'm currently running FC6 64 on an AMD Athon 64 X2
> system.
>
> I have the FC6 32bit 6.5 rpm installed but am getting an
> "thread_get_info_callback: cannot get thread info: generic error"
> when trying to debug programs linked with libpthread.so.
>
> So thought I'd try 6.6.
You just need to set CC or CFLAGS appropriately before running
configure. However, I know of at least one kernel bug in the x86_64
ptrace emulation for 32-bit processes, so I really don't recommend
doing this if you can avoid it - I would expect trouble with thread
debugging as a symptom of that.
